@font-face{font-family:Abraham Shadow;src:url("/fonts/7 ABRAHAM SHADOW DEMO.OTF")format("opentype")}@font-face{font-family:Hughs;src:url(/fonts/HUGHS.OTF)format("opentype")}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{color:#333;background:linear-gradient(135deg,#e8f3ea 0%,#d4e8e0 25%,#c9dcd8 50%,#d4e8e0 75%,#e8f3ea 100%) 0 0/400% 400%;font-family:Arial,sans-serif;animation:15s infinite gradientShift;position:relative;overflow-x:hidden}body:before{content:"";filter:blur(55px);opacity:.9;mix-blend-mode:multiply;pointer-events:none;z-index:0;background-image:radial-gradient(circle at 20%,#4caf7873 0%,#0000 42%),radial-gradient(circle at 80% 80%,#2e7d5a59 0%,#0000 38%),radial-gradient(circle at 40% 20%,#81c78466 0%,#0000 40%),radial-gradient(circle at 60% 60%,#66bb6a40 0%,#0000 35%);background-size:250% 250%,180% 180%,220% 220%,160% 160%;animation:18s infinite moveGradient,24s ease-in-out infinite moveGradient2;position:fixed;inset:0}@keyframes gradientShift{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}@keyframes moveGradient{0%,to{background-position:0 0,100% 100%,50%}50%{background-position:100% 100%,0 0,50% 0}}@keyframes moveGradient2{0%,to{background-position:0 0,100% 100%,50%}50%{background-position:0 100%,50% 0,100%}}body::-webkit-scrollbar{background:0 0;width:0}a{color:inherit;text-decoration:none}@media (max-width:768px){body{overflow-x:hidden}html{font-size:14px}}@media (max-width:480px){html{font-size:13px}body:before{filter:blur(40px)}}button{cursor:pointer;font:inherit;background:0 0;border:none}
